Blame just is an aspect of our already-existing, inborn deterrent system. Saying we shouldn't blame and instead deter, is like saying we shouldn't deter and instead deter.

I suppose he wanted to say that we should make deterrence our ultimate goal and use blame instrumentally, instead of having blame as our terminal value with deterrence being only a consequence thereof, which is the way it basically works now.
